Background
The applicant, Masvingo City Council, sought an urgent chamber application to stay execution of a registered arbitral award relating to salary increments for its employees. The award had been registered as a court order on 9 October 2012, but the applicant only acted on 7 December 2012 when execution proceedings commenced.
